[Claims for Utility Model Registration] (1) A compression side oil passage and an extension side oil passage are formed in the piston, and a compression side valve that opens and closes the compression side oil passage and a compression side oil passage that opens and closes the expansion side oil passage are provided on both sides of the piston. In a valve mechanism for a shock absorber that is provided with a rebound valve, a sub-oil passage that bypasses the valve is provided in parallel with the oil passage, and this sub-oil passage has a sub-valve that opens and closes this sub-oil passage on the expansion-side valve side. established,
This sub-valve consists of a fixed disc valve with an oil hole formed therein and a floating valve facing the oil hole of this disc valve, and furthermore, an inner ring and an outer ring are connected between the fixed disc valve and the floating valve by a connecting piece. A valve mechanism for a shock absorber characterized by interposing a seat valve formed by: (2) A shock absorber in which a compression side oil passage and a rebound oil passage are formed in the piston, and a compression side valve that opens and closes the compression side oil passage and a growth side valve that opens and closes the expansion side oil passage are provided on both sides of the piston. In the valve mechanism of the device, a sub-oil passage is provided in parallel with the oil passage to bypass the valve, and this sub-oil passage is provided with a sub-valve that opens and closes this sub-oil passage on the compression side valve side,
This sub-valve consists of a fixed disc valve with an oil hole formed therein and a floating valve facing the oil hole of this disc valve, and furthermore, an inner ring and an outer ring are connected between the fixed disc valve and the floating valve by a connecting piece. A valve mechanism for a shock absorber characterized by interposing a seat valve formed by:
